How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Creekside?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Creekside Studio Apartments | $2,142 | $1,795 | $2,589 |
Creekside 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,889 | $1,816 | $5,464 |
Creekside 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,555 | $2,495 | $6,812 |
Creekside 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,354 | $3,021 | $3,710 |
Creekside 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,360 | $3,360 | $3,360 |
